The invention enters a cover, in particular loudspeaker cover, made of a metallic material, with a perforated sound exit region (14) and an edge region (16) which forms at least part of a frame (17) surrounding the sound exit region (14), the frame (17 ) is formed by forming relative to the sound exit region (14) and extends outside the plane of the sound exit region (14), wherein the frame (17) at least partially comprises a perforated segment (21) with perforation holes (25). According to some embodiments, at least one light guide (36) is provided which is associated with an inner side (34) of the frame (17).

Such speaker covers made of a metallic material have a sound exit area, which is formed perforated. In this case, this sound outlet region may comprise perforation holes or a lattice structure or an expanded metal optic. A frame of the cover is formed by a bead against the sound exit area and extends outside the plane of the sound exit area to attach the cover to the housing of the speaker.

This can allow excess material to flow or dodge into the perforation holes of the hole segments during the beading process or the forming, that is to say that the metallic, plate-shaped material is reduced by the perforation holes in the region of the at least one hole segment, so that a Flow allows and a wave formation of the frame is prevented. As a result, increased dimensional accuracy for the cover can also be achieved due to a lack of reaction of the superfluous material on the sound exit area.

This creates a visually appealing design of the cover, so that the sound exit region, if desired, is surrounded by an unperforated segment region, which extends to the optically outer edge of the cover, that is, the frame is opposite the optically outer edge of the Formed cover and extends towards the rear of the cover of the cover. As a result, the introduced into the frame hole segments are not externally visible after forming and still allow a flow of excess metallic material into individual cavities of the perforation holes. Alternatively it can be provided that the non-perforated segment region surrounding the sound absorption region is designed as a narrow, strip-shaped region in order to form only a separation between the frame for beading and the sound exit region.

As a result, a simplification and cost reduction in the production of the perforation holes in the frame and in the sound exit area can be achieved. As a processing method, in particular, an etching method is provided. As a result, both different structures and deviating perforation holes can be produced inexpensively. Furthermore, a laser processing, in particular laser cutting or evaporation by laser beam pulses, as well as a stamped nipple processing provided be. Also, a chemical sinking is possible.

In diesem Bereich erfolgt insbesondere beim Umformen eine dreidimensionale Verformung des plattenförmigen Materials, durch welches quasi überschüssiges Material generiert wird, so dass durch die vorherige Bildung der Perforationslöcher eine Kompensation des aus der Umformung resultierenden überschüssigen Materials ermöglicht ist.The at least one hole segment of the frame extends at least in a region which extends from a plate-shaped material for introducing the perforation holes of the exit region and a subsequent deformation along a curved or curved course of the edge of the cover. In this area, in particular when forming a three-dimensional deformation of the plate-shaped material is generated by which quasi excess material, so that a compensation of the excess material resulting from the deformation is made possible by the previous formation of the perforation.
